Superintendent - 2nd Shift

Smithfield Foods
Kansas
Workplace: OnsiteFull timeFunction: Manufacturing & Production OperationsExperience: 3+ yearsEducation: bachelorsSkills: ["Leadership","Training","Coaching","Continuous improvement","Safety focus"]

Lead a dynamic multi-shift production environment by coordinating Production Supervisors to hit daily targets and maintain high-quality output. Monitor yields, efficiencies, and profitability, manage staffing and production schedules, and stay operationally flexible. Drive safety and ergonomic programs, ensure sanitation and quality compliance with USDA and company standards, and conduct line meetings that reinforce expectations. Train teams, support continuous improvement, and provide leadership on the production floor.

Key Responsibilities

  • •Drive operational efficiency and profitability by monitoring daily/weekly yields, efficiencies, and profitability, and taking corrective actions as needed.
  • •Manage staffing and production schedules to meet customer needs and optimize resources.
  • •Champion safety and ergonomics by developing and implementing safety/ergonomic programs and training employees on safe work practices.
  • •Ensure quality and compliance by upholding sanitation, product quality, and customer service standards in line with USDA and company regulations.
  • •Provide leadership and guidance, conduct line meetings, train supervisors and employees, and drive continuous improvement initiatives to enhance plant performance.

Company Brief

Smithfield Foods
Produces pork and packaged meat products, operating integrated hog production, processing, and branded food businesses. It supplies retail, foodservice, and export markets across the United States and internationally.
